Khodorkovsky to MEPs About pro-Kremlin’s Influence in the EU

Exiled businessman Mikhail Khodorkovsky at a public hearing of the European Parliment told to MEPs: Russia has recruited allies in Angela Merkel’s German chancellor’s “inner circle” so as in the Austrian intelligence services.

One of the earliest and most well known Russian ologarch, Khodorkovsky with his UK-based pro-democracy NGO, The Dossier Centre published in a 60-page report made available to MEPs via a secure website.

The report details how a wider pro-Kremlin network ouf EU member states work including Czech Republic, Cyprus, France, Greece, Latvia, Lithuania, and Poland and Hungary.

Khodorkovsky explained how a circle of pro-Russia MEP were built and where were attempts in the recent years from France to Cyprus to intervene with national politics with Russian interests and financed actions.
